Brazil: Apan/Eleva/Blumenau – Minas Tenis Clube 3-0 in postponement of Round 20
1 min read
In postponement of Round 20, Blumenau defeated Minas 3-0, climbing to a historic fifth place (goal never reached) in the standings 2 rounds in advance from the end of the Regular Season. Minas, who paid for Escobar’s absence for covid and Honorato’s bad evening, practically say goodbye to third place, now in the hands of Renata Campinas. Among the hosts an excellent match for the opposite Franco Paese (top scorer with 17 points, 48% in attack, 3 blocks and 1 ace) and outside hitter Gabriel Pessoa (MVP with 13 points, 73% in attack and 2 aces).
